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Marple to London Charing Cross start from as little as £34.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Marple to London Charing Cross start from £76.30 one way, or £109.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Marple to London Charing Cross are available for £198.50 one way, or £397.00 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Marple Station is well-furnished with facilities aimed at ensuring a seamless experience for all commuters. A ticket office stands ready to serve passengers from early morning until late in the evening on weekdays and weekends, complete with accessible ticket machines that make purchasing or collecting your ticket a breeze. While you’re there, take advantage of smartcard services available at the station, although it is worth noting that validators are currently unavailable. Accessibility is well-addressed here, with step-free access provided throughout the station—a true Category A station equipped with lifts and a level access point.

For added convenience, the station offers customer information via departure screens and announcements, although there are no dedicated waiting rooms. Fear not, though; seating areas are available. The station is under the watchful eye of CCTV to ensure your security, leaving you with one less thing to worry about as you traverse through.

Onward Travel from Marple Station

If your journey doesn’t end at Marple, fret not. The station is well-linked to various transport services, allowing for smooth transitions between travel modes. Buses frequent Brabyns Brow, carrying passengers to bustling locales like Hyde, Manchester, Stockport, or Romiley. For those in need of taxis, Northern Railway offers a handy Cab4you service to help push your travels stress-free.

Although the station itself doesn’t offer underground or metro services, the Greater Manchester Passenger Transport Executive (GMPTE) ensures continuous connectivity within the city, helping you journey wherever your plans take you with ease and efficiency.

Station Facilities and Services

Charing Cross station provides a range of facilities designed to make your journey as smooth and accessible as possible. For starters, the ticket office is open every day of the week, and ticket machines are available round the clock, allowing for seamless ticket purchases and collections. The station ensures accessibility with step-free access throughout and wheelchair assistance. You can find accessible toilets and induction loops installed at various points for those who are hearing impaired.

Waiting times at Charing Cross are comfortable with partially or fully covered canopies stretching across platforms, though there is no dedicated first-class lounge or seating area. For dining and retail therapy, the main concourse offers refreshment facilities, shops, and ATM machines, although a currency exchange service isn’t available on-site.

Transport Connections

Reaching your next destination from London Charing Cross is a breeze, thanks to the numerous transport links available. A 24-hour taxi rank is located just outside the station's main entrance. Things get even more convenient with buses operating on The Strand. For those preferring to navigate the city below ground, both the Bakerloo and Northern lines are accessible from Charing Cross.

Should you want to embrace some pedal power, Santander hire cycles are located near the station. Details are available here.
